1. Tank Dimensions

Tank dimensions play a vital function in calculating the required substrate quantity. Whereas a 20-gallon tank nominally holds 20 gallons of water, tanks labeled with the identical gallon capability can have various lengths, widths, and heights. A 20-gallon “excessive” tank has a smaller footprint (size and width) and better peak in comparison with a 20-gallon “lengthy” tank. This distinction in footprint immediately impacts the substrate calculation. A bigger footprint requires a better quantity of substrate to attain the identical depth. As an illustration, attaining a 2-inch depth in a 20-gallon lengthy tank would require significantly extra substrate than attaining the identical depth in a 20-gallon excessive tank. Precisely measuring the size and width of the tank’s base is important for calculating the mandatory substrate quantity.

Think about two hypothetical 20-gallon tanks: Tank A measures 30 inches lengthy by 12 inches extensive, whereas Tank B measures 24 inches lengthy by 18 inches extensive. Despite the fact that each maintain 20 gallons, Tank A has a smaller footprint (360 sq. inches) than Tank B (432 sq. inches). Due to this fact, Tank B would require a bigger quantity of substrate to attain the identical depth as Tank A. This precept applies to all aquarium configurations and dimensions. Ignoring the footprint and relying solely on the gallon capability can result in vital errors in substrate calculations, leading to both too little or an excessive amount of substrate.

2. Desired Depth

Desired substrate depth considerably influences the entire quantity wanted for a 20-gallon aquarium. This depth just isn’t arbitrary; it immediately correlates with the meant function and inhabitants of the tank. A shallow substrate mattress, usually 1-1.5 inches, usually suffices for fish-only tanks the place the substrate primarily serves as an aesthetic base. Nevertheless, planted tanks necessitate deeper substrates, usually 2-3 inches or extra, to accommodate root methods and supply satisfactory area for nutrient absorption and anchoring. Particular plant species could require even better depths, notably these with in depth root methods. Fish species that burrow or sift by the substrate additionally affect depth necessities. As an illustration, sure cichlids favor deeper substrates for digging and territory institution. Deciding on an inappropriate depth can negatively affect plant progress, fish conduct, and the general stability of the aquatic surroundings.

Think about a 20-gallon tank meant for a closely planted aquascape. Choosing a shallow 1-inch substrate depth would possibly prohibit root improvement, resulting in stunted plant progress and nutrient deficiencies. Conversely, a deep substrate mattress in a tank housing bottom-dwelling fish that require open swimming areas might restrict their pure behaviors and create pointless territorial disputes. A planted tank with a 3-inch substrate depth would require a considerably bigger quantity of fabric in comparison with a fish-only tank with a 1-inch depth, even throughout the similar 20-gallon capability. Understanding the interaction between desired depth, tank inhabitants, and total aquascaping objectives permits for knowledgeable selections relating to substrate quantity.

Calculating the mandatory substrate quantity requires multiplying the tank’s footprint (size multiplied by width) by the specified depth. This calculation supplies the amount in cubic inches. Changing cubic inches to extra sensible models like liters or quarts usually simplifies the acquisition course of. 3. Substrate Kind

Substrate kind considerably influences the calculation for a 20-gallon tank. Completely different substrates possess various densities and particle sizes, immediately impacting the amount required to attain a selected depth. As an illustration, high quality sand packs extra densely than gravel, which means a smaller quantity of sand achieves the identical depth as a bigger quantity of gravel. This density distinction necessitates cautious consideration of substrate kind when calculating the required quantity. Utilizing gravel would possibly require twice the amount in comparison with sand for a similar depth. Moreover, sure substrates, like specialised planted tank substrates, include vitamins or particular properties that, whereas useful for plant progress, would possibly affect their density and thus the amount calculations. Selecting the wrong quantity primarily based on a mismatched substrate kind can result in both an inadequate mattress depth or extra substrate, impacting the aquascape’s aesthetics and the well-being of the inhabitants. For instance, utilizing a smaller quantity of gravel than needed for a desired depth might lead to uncovered tank backside, hindering plant anchoring and probably affecting water parameters.

Think about a 20-gallon tank meant for a planted setup. If the specified depth is 3 inches and the chosen substrate is okay sand, the required quantity can be significantly lower than if the chosen substrate is coarse gravel. This distinction arises from the tighter packing of sand particles in comparison with the looser association of gravel. Utilizing the identical quantity for each substrates would lead to a shallower depth for the gravel, probably inadequate for correct plant root improvement. Conversely, utilizing the amount applicable for gravel with sand would result in an excessively deep substrate mattress. Moreover, specialised planted tank substrates usually include light-weight, porous supplies that, whereas useful for root progress, would possibly alter quantity calculations. These substrates would possibly require a bigger quantity to attain the specified depth in comparison with inert substrates like sand or gravel. 4. Plant Wants

Plant wants immediately affect substrate depth and kind choice in a 20-gallon aquarium. Profitable aquatic plant cultivation requires cautious consideration of rooting depth, nutrient necessities, and substrate composition. Understanding these components ensures a thriving planted tank surroundings.

  • Rooting Depth

    Completely different aquatic plant species exhibit various root system sizes and constructions. Species with in depth root methods, akin to swords and crypts, require deeper substrates to accommodate their progress and supply satisfactory anchoring. Conversely, crops with smaller or much less developed root methods, like sure floating crops or mosses, could thrive in shallower substrates and even with no conventional substrate. Deciding on the suitable depth primarily based on plant species prevents root restriction and promotes wholesome progress.

  • Nutrient Necessities

    Aquatic crops require important vitamins for progress and improvement. Whereas some vitamins are derived from the water column, the substrate performs a vital function in offering a secure supply of vitamins, notably for root-feeding species. Nutrient-rich substrates, or the addition of root tabs beneath the substrate, can profit demanding plant species. Understanding nutrient necessities influences substrate selection, as some substrates supply inherent nutrient content material, whereas others require supplementation.

  • Substrate Composition

    Substrate composition influences water parameters and plant well being. Sure substrates can alter water pH or hardness, impacting plant suitability. Inert substrates, like sand or gravel, present a secure base however could lack important vitamins. Specialised planted tank substrates usually include natural matter or mineral elements that improve nutrient availability and promote useful microbial progress, supporting plant well being. Deciding on a substrate suitable with plant wants and desired water parameters is essential for a thriving planted tank.

  • Oxygenation inside Substrate

    Satisfactory oxygenation throughout the substrate is important for wholesome root improvement and prevents the buildup of anaerobic micro organism, which may be detrimental to plant well being. Substrate particle measurement and composition affect oxygen diffusion. Finer substrates, whereas aesthetically pleasing, can typically prohibit oxygen stream. Coarser substrates usually present higher oxygenation, selling wholesome root respiration. Incorporating useful micro organism and avoiding over-compaction of the substrate additional improve oxygenation.

5. Fish Species

Fish species inhabiting a 20-gallon tank considerably affect substrate concerns. Completely different species exhibit various behaviors and preferences relating to substrate kind and depth. These preferences immediately affect the suitable substrate selection for a thriving aquarium surroundings. Backside-dwelling species, akin to Corydoras catfish or sure loaches, usually favor sand or high quality gravel substrates, enabling pure foraging and sifting behaviors. These species could expertise stress or harm if housed on coarse gravel or sharp substrates. Conversely, species that favor open swimming areas, like many tetras or danios, are much less affected by substrate kind, although a shallower depth usually maximizes accessible swimming area. Cichlids, identified for territorial behaviors and digging, usually profit from deeper sand or gravel beds, permitting them to create burrows and set up territories. Ignoring species-specific substrate preferences can result in stress, behavioral points, and even bodily hurt to the fish.

Think about a 20-gallon tank meant to deal with a group of Corydoras catfish. Selecting coarse gravel as a substrate might forestall these fish from successfully sifting for meals, resulting in dietary deficiencies and stress. Alternatively, a deep sand mattress, whereas appropriate for Corydoras, could be inappropriate for a tank housing hatchet fish, which primarily occupy the higher water column and require open swimming area. Equally, offering a shallow substrate for cichlids identified for digging might prohibit their pure behaviors and result in elevated aggression throughout the tank. A sensible instance is the distinction between a South American biotope aquarium, which frequently includes a sandy substrate for species like angelfish and discus, and an African Rift Lake cichlid tank, which generally makes use of aragonite or crushed coral substrates to buffer the water and replicate their pure surroundings. 6. Aquascaping Targets

Aquascaping objectives considerably affect substrate selections in a 20-gallon tank. Completely different aquascape types necessitate particular substrate depths, sorts, and preparations. A minimalist aquascape that includes a number of hardscape components and low-growing crops would possibly require a shallower substrate depth in comparison with a densely planted “Dutch fashion” aquascape, which necessitates a deeper substrate to accommodate in depth root methods. Iwagumi aquascapes, characterised by rigorously organized rocks and minimal plants, usually make the most of various substrate depths to create slopes and valleys, including visible depth and curiosity. Equally, biotope aquariums replicating particular pure habitats require substrate selections that precisely replicate the native surroundings. As an illustration, a blackwater biotope mimicking the Amazon River basin would possibly make the most of leaf litter and high quality sand, whereas a Tanganyika Lake biotope would profit from crushed coral or aragonite to buffer the water and replicate the pure substrate. Disregarding aquascaping objectives may end up in an unsuitable substrate selection, hindering plant progress, disrupting the aesthetic steadiness, and probably impacting the well being of the aquarium inhabitants.

Think about a 20-gallon tank meant for a “Nature Aquarium” fashion aquascape, characterised by dense planting and complicated hardscape preparations. Choosing a shallow substrate would prohibit root improvement, impacting plant well being and hindering the specified aesthetic. Conversely, a deep substrate in a minimalist aquascape would possibly seem disproportionate and detract from the meant visible simplicity. Sensible examples embody using sloping substrates in iwagumi layouts to create visible depth and the incorporation of nutrient-rich substrates in planted tanks to help strong plant progress. An aquascaper aiming to recreate a selected biotope surroundings should rigorously analysis the pure substrate composition to make sure an correct and thriving illustration throughout the aquarium.

Incessantly Requested Questions

This part addresses frequent inquiries relating to substrate choice and calculation for 20-gallon aquariums.

Query 1: How does one calculate the mandatory substrate quantity for a 20-gallon tank?

Correct calculation includes multiplying the tank’s size by its width after which multiplying the outcome by the specified substrate depth. This yields the amount in cubic inches, which may be transformed to liters or quarts. On-line calculators can simplify this course of. Exact measurements of tank dimensions are essential for correct calculations.

Query 2: Can extra substrate hurt aquarium inhabitants?

Whereas a barely deeper substrate mattress than needed is mostly not dangerous, extreme substrate depth can prohibit water circulation throughout the decrease layers, probably resulting in anaerobic bacterial progress and the discharge of dangerous gases. It will possibly additionally make it harder to wash the substrate successfully. Uneaten meals and waste can turn out to be trapped deep inside a really thick substrate layer, creating pockets of decay that have an effect on water high quality.

Query 3: Is it essential to rinse substrate earlier than including it to the tank?

Rinsing most substrates earlier than including them to the aquarium is mostly really helpful. This course of removes high quality mud and particles that may cloud the water. Pre-washed substrates would possibly nonetheless profit from a fast rinse to make sure optimum readability. Rinsing additionally helps take away any residual manufacturing byproducts.

Query 4: Can totally different substrate sorts be combined throughout the similar tank?

Mixing substrate sorts is feasible and infrequently fascinating for aesthetic or practical functions. Creating distinct areas with totally different substrates can add visible curiosity and cater to the particular wants of assorted plant or fish species. Nevertheless, take into account potential mixing or shifting of substrates over time because of water stream or fish exercise. Terracing or bodily obstacles throughout the tank will help keep distinct substrate zones.

Query 5: How usually ought to aquarium substrate get replaced?

Substrate alternative frequency varies relying on components akin to substrate kind, stocking ranges, and upkeep practices. Inert substrates like gravel or sand can final for a number of years with correct upkeep, whereas nutrient-rich substrates would possibly require replenishment or alternative sooner. Common gravel vacuuming throughout water adjustments helps take away gathered particles and keep substrate well being.

Query 6: Are there particular substrates really helpful for planted tanks?

Planted tanks usually profit from specialised substrates designed to offer important vitamins and help strong root improvement. These substrates usually include a mixture of natural matter, minerals, and useful micro organism. Examples embody ADA Aqua Soil, Fluval Stratum, and Eco-Full. Selecting the best planted tank substrate relies on particular plant wants and aquascaping objectives.

Ideas for Calculating and Utilizing Substrate in a 20-Gallon Tank

Correct substrate choice and software are essential for a thriving 20-gallon aquarium. The following pointers present sensible steering for attaining optimum outcomes.

Tip 1: Measure Precisely:
Correct tank dimensions are important. Use a ruler or measuring tape to acquire exact size and width measurements. Keep away from estimations, as even small discrepancies can have an effect on substrate calculations.

Tip 2: Think about Desired Depth:
Substrate depth ought to align with aquascaping objectives and the wants of the inhabitants. Analysis plant species and fish preferences to find out appropriate depths. A deeper substrate is usually needed for planted tanks.

Tip 3: Account for Substrate Kind:
Completely different substrates have various densities. Tremendous sand requires much less quantity than coarser gravel for a similar depth. Think about the particular substrate’s properties when calculating the required quantity.

Tip 4: Pre-Rinse Totally:
Rinse the substrate totally earlier than including it to the tank to take away mud and particles, guaranteeing clear water and stopping potential water high quality points. Use a high quality mesh sieve or devoted substrate rinse bucket.

Tip 5: Slope the Substrate (Optionally available):
Sloping the substrate from again to entrance can create visible depth and improve the aquascape’s aesthetics. This system additionally aids in directing particles in the direction of the entrance of the tank, facilitating simpler cleansing.

Tip 6: Plan for Hardscape:
Incorporating rocks, driftwood, or different hardscape components requires adjusting substrate calculations. Place hardscape components earlier than including the substrate to forestall disturbing the structure later. Guarantee hardscape is secure and won’t shift or collapse.

Tip 7: Keep away from Over-Compaction:
Keep away from excessively compacting the substrate, particularly in planted tanks. Mild placement and distribution enable for satisfactory water circulation and oxygenation throughout the substrate, supporting wholesome root improvement.

Tip 8: Observe and Alter:
Monitor plant progress, fish conduct, and water parameters after organising the aquarium. Changes to substrate depth or kind could be needed primarily based on observations. Common upkeep, akin to gravel vacuuming, ensures long-term substrate well being.
